2025 Toyota RAV4
What stays physical
The Toyota RAV4 remains among the most recognizable examples of a modern SUV with a substantial hardware rhythm. In base trims, the climactic draw isn’t just its reliability; it’s a cockpit that still relies on a host of tangible controls. Expect at least 40 distinct buttons and three dedicated knobs, with 19 buttons on the steering wheel alone. The left cluster of the wheel handles media navigation and volume, while the right handles driver-assist toggles and cruise control. A cluster of HVAC controls sits below the infotainment screen, and there are four overhead cabin lights plus an SOS button for emergencies.

Bottom line: how to evaluate a tactile-heavy interior
When shopping for a car that respects physical controls, there are a few things to consider beyond the obvious presence of knobs and buttons. First, assess the layout: are the essential controls reachable with a natural hand position, or do you have to lean forward or stretch? Second, test during real driving: can you adjust volume, climate, and safety settings without looking away from the road? Third, examine the quality and durability of the controls: are the buttons clearly labeled, and do the knobs rotate smoothly? Finally, consider the trade-off with a touchscreen: does the screen complement the tactile controls, or does it complicate the interface with redundant inputs? These questions help ensure a practical, safe, and satisfying driving experience in a world where screens dominate yet physical controls persist.
FAQ
Why do some new cars still prioritize physical buttons and knobs?
Physical controls offer tactile feedback, faster access, and improved usability when the vehicle is in motion or the weather is poor. They reduce the cognitive load of menu diving and help drivers keep their eyes on the road while making essential adjustments.
Which models are most likely to keep tactile controls in 2026?
Across several brands, base trims of popular SUVs and trucks tend to emphasize physical controls for HVAC, volume, and safety settings. Look for models that balance a modern touchscreen with a dedicated row of knobs and buttons, especially for climate control and steering-wheel inputs.
Are there safety advantages to physical controls?
Yes. Tactile controls can lower glance time and reduce distraction. Physical buttons are often more reliable in extreme temperatures and don’t rely on software responses, which can lag or fail under heavy use.
What about the aesthetics of touchscreens vs. physical controls?
Many buyers appreciate the clean, minimal look of a touchscreen, but manufacturers that preserve physical controls argue that a well-designed hybrid interface gives the best of both worlds: modern visuals with dependable, immediate tactile feedback.
How should I test a car’s interface before buying?
During a test drive, try adjusting climate, volume, and safety settings at speed, switching between touch and physical controls, and using the wheel-mounted controls. Note how intuitive the layout feels and whether you can operate critical functions without taking your eyes off the road.
